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2016 Extraire un nom dans une cellule

  • Initiateur de la discussion Initiateur de la discussion etorria
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

etorria

XLDnaute Nouveau
Bonjour !

Je cherche à extraire le nom et le prénom dans une cellule comportant également des chiffres comme par exemple DUPONT PAUL 12345678 pour obtenir au final le résultat DUPONT PAUL.

Merci à vous.

Etorria
 
Bonjour.
Donnée d'origine en A1, essayez :
VB:
=S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(SUBSTITUE(A1;0;"");1;"");2;"");3;"");4;"");5;"");6;"");7;"");8;"");9;"")

Fonctionne également avec DA SILVA DE TORRES Joan Garcia 999231234567890
 
Bonjour Ettoria, JHA,
Une variante :
VB:
=GAUCHE(A1;CHERCHE(" ";A1)+CHERCHE(" ";STXT(A1;1+CHERCHE(" ";A1);100)))
Elle est indépendante du nombre de chiffres. La seule limite est que la "phrase" doit comporter deux espaces.
 

Pièces jointes

Bonjour etorria, JHA, Patrick, sylvanu,

Voyez le fichier joint et cette formule matricielle en B2 :
Code:
=SUPPRESPACE(GAUCHE(A2;MIN(SI(ESTNUM(-STXT(A2&1;LIGNE(INDIRECT("1:"&NBCAR(A2)+1));1));LIGNE(INDIRECT("1:"&NBCAR(A2)+1))))-1))
A+
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
4
Affichages
116
Réponses
7
Affichages
266
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…